3 Hospitalized after Highway 101 Crash in Santa Rosa

3 Injured in Santa Rosa Three-Car Accident on Highway 101 near Airport Boulevard

Santa Rosa, California (January 16, 2020) – Three people were hospitalized Tuesday morning after a multi-vehicle crash in Santa Rosa, the California Highway Patrol reported.

The accident took place at about 7:49 a.m. Tuesday, January 14 on Highway 101, just north of the Airport Boulevard exit ramp.

The CHP said three vehicles collided on Highway 101. One of the involved vehicles, identified as a white Toyota truck, was driving recklessly on the highway before the collision.

Three people sustained minor injuries and were transported to a hospital. Their names and conditions at this time remained undisclosed.

No other details about the accident were given.

An investigation into the crash is ongoing.
